The Vimy Foundation/La Fondation Vimy is a charitable organization based in Montreal, Quebec, classified by the CRA under support of schools and education. In its fiscal year ending December 31, 2024, it reported $1.4M in revenue and $1.4M in expenditures.
Its funding that year was roughly 51% from donations, 5% from government, 35% from other charities. In 2024, 15 other registered charities reported granting it a combined $683K.
Compared with 632 education charities of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 67% of peers. Its highest-paid position fell in the $80,000–119,999 range. The charity reported 4 permanent full-time positions.
Revenue has grown substantially over its filings on record here, from $599K in 2020 to $1.4M in 2024. Its filed list of directors and trustees shows 12 names.
In its own words
To forge closer links between young people in canada uk and france to understand their history and culture and appreciate the bravery horror and futility of war. 20177 education centre: fundraising campaign for construction of new education centre in vimy ridge. Centennial: fundraising campaign for the 100th years of vimy battle. Encounters with canada: education program in ottawa at encounters with canada beaverbrook vimy prize: education programe where students are sent to europe to study first and second world wars. Pilgrimage :education programe where students are sent to europe to study…
